Arrested for Trampling on Japanese Flag

(Received 1.30 p.m.) T£)KIO, January 25,

A Nagoya report states that seven j members of the crew of the steamer j Fevernleigh, under charter to a Japan- | tse firm, were arrested for hauling

j down and trampling on two Japanese j flags on January 22. I A later cable message states that j five of the crew have been released and returned to their ships.
